### Changelog — ProfileVault sharding defaults

Heads up for the eng sync: as of this week, ProfileVault ships with sharding on by default. We got tired of every new region team rediscovering the resharding dance, so the hash-ring setup, replica counts, and rebalance throttles all have sane out-of-the-box values now. Old single-shard deployments keep working, but the migration tool will nag you. If you run a fork, diff your overrides before deploying. The new defaults are listed below.

service settings:
PRAIX_LOG_LEVEL=error
PRAIX_METRICS_HOST=metrics.praix.qorvelcorp.corp
PRAIX_POOL_SIZE=16

Handover note – weekly cash-box run

Mira, covering you while you're out. The Thursday cash-box run to the Selbourne branch is all set: box is counted, sealed, and in the safe room, receipt pad on top. Courier is Drayton Secure this week, not the usual firm — their driver comes at 09:15, earlier than Corvale used to. Don't release the box before the escort signs the manifest, and keep the second key on site. At the hand-over itself, follow this:

handover note for yagef-bagep: the drudor pelius courier leaves the kasdor zorvan norir ledger at gate 8016 under passcode 755406

The reminder job in Clinwell's scheduler (`remind-daily`) wakes up every 15 minutes, grabs appointments in the next 48 hours, and fires SMS/email through the Pagerbird relay. If it seems stuck, check the `last_cursor` row first — nine times out of ten that's the culprit. The job authenticates to the appointments API with a bearer token loaded at startup, shown below for the sandbox environment.

session JWT of yawep-yawep = eyJhbGciOiJIUzI1NiIsInR5cCI6IkpXVCJ9.eyJzdWIiOiI3pWF3_In0.aXYsHiog

**Ticket: Monthly partitioning misroutes late-arriving rows**

In the Quillbase warehouse, the orders table is partitioned by month, but rows with timestamps near midnight on the last day of a month occasionally land in the following month's partition. Root cause appears to be a timezone normalization step applied after the partition key is computed. Impact is limited to reporting totals. The regression was introduced in the build identified by the token below.

trace token, fafog-kageg: htk4_98e6